3. Eukaryotic cells package their DNA by wrapping short stretches of it around the rims of disk- shaped proteins called histones. Typically, a 150 base-pair segment of DNA (0.34 nm/base-pair) wraps itself 1.7 times around the histone core. DNA's persistence length is 53 nm and recall that persistence length is equal to the flexural rigidity (ke) divided by KbT.
